In this Saturday, Aug. 3, 2024 photo provided by Nancy Doherty, Ben Doherty, of Braintree, Mass., left, and his cousin Danny Doherty, 12, of Norwood, Mass., right, sit at a homemade ice cream stand near Danny's home in Norwood. (Nancy Doherty via AP)

News, Photo and Web Search

Other Photos

Previous Photo